#include "implicit_f.inc"#include "com01_c.inc"#include "sms_c.inc"#include "timeri_c.inc"#include "units_c.inc"#include "com04_c.inc"#include "comlock.inc"#include "mvsiz_p.inc"#include "parit_c.inc"#include "lockon.inc"#include "lockoff.inc"Go to the source code of this file.
Functions/Subroutines | |
| subroutine | sms_inist (timers, iadk, jdik, diag_k, lt_k, itask, nodft1_sms, nodlt1_sms, indx1_sms, nodnx_sms, iad_elem, fr_elem, weight, jadi_sms, jdii_sms, lti_sms, iskyi_sms, mskyi_sms, fr_sms, fr_rms, list_sms, list_rms, mskyi_fi_sms, vfi, imv, mv, mv6, mw6, ms, nodft, nodlt) |
| subroutine | sms_inix (timers, nodft, nodlt, numnod, x, r, weight, itask, diag_sms) |
| subroutine | sms_pro_p (timers, nodft, nodlt, numnod, p, weight, itask, pj, diag_sms) |
| subroutine | sms_updst (iadk, jdik, diag_k, lt_k, itask, nodft1_sms, nodlt1_sms, indx1_sms, nodnx_sms, iad_elem, fr_elem, weight, jadi_sms, jdii_sms, lti_sms, iskyi_sms, mskyi_sms, fr_sms, fr_rms, list_sms, list_rms, mskyi_fi_sms, vfi, imv, mv, mv6, mw6, ms, u, p, y, nodft, nodlt, kinet) |
| subroutine | sms_inisi (iadk, jdik, diag_k, lt_k, itask, nodft1_sms, nodlt1_sms, indx1_sms, nodnx_sms, iad_elem, fr_elem, weight, jadi_sms, jdii_sms, lti_sms, iskyi_sms, mskyi_sms, fr_sms, fr_rms, list_sms, list_rms, mskyi_fi_sms, vfi, imv, mv, mv6, mw6, ms, nodft, nodlt, prec_sms, kinet) |
| subroutine | sms_inis (numnod, nodft, nodlt, npf, npl, s, nodnx_sms, kinet) |
| subroutine | sms_produt_h (nodft, nodlt, x, y, weight, r, itask) |
| subroutine | sms_produt3 (nodft, nodlt, x, y, weight, r, itask) |
| subroutine | sms_mav_nm (nodft, nodlt, numnod, md, a, b, c, weight, itask) |
| subroutine | sms_mam_nm (nodft, nodlt, numnod, md, a, b, c, weight, itask) |
| subroutine | sms_mortho_gs (nodft, nodlt, numnod, md_f, md_l, a, weight, itask) |
| subroutine | sms_mav_mn (nd, md, a, b, c, itask) |
| subroutine | sms_produt_v_loc (nddl, x, y, r) |
| subroutine sms_inis | ( | integer | numnod, |
| integer | nodft, | ||
| integer | nodlt, | ||
| integer | npf, | ||
| integer | npl, | ||
| s, | |||
| integer, dimension(*) | nodnx_sms, | ||
| integer, dimension(*) | kinet ) |
Definition at line 606 of file sms_proj.F.
| subroutine sms_inisi | ( | integer, dimension(*) | iadk, |
| integer, dimension(*) | jdik, | ||
| diag_k, | |||
| lt_k, | |||
| integer | itask, | ||
| integer | nodft1_sms, | ||
| integer | nodlt1_sms, | ||
| integer, dimension(*) | indx1_sms, | ||
| integer, dimension(*) | nodnx_sms, | ||
| integer, dimension(2,nspmd+1) | iad_elem, | ||
| integer, dimension(*) | fr_elem, | ||
| integer, dimension(*) | weight, | ||
| integer, dimension(*) | jadi_sms, | ||
| integer, dimension(*) | jdii_sms, | ||
| lti_sms, | |||
| integer, dimension(lskyi_sms,*) | iskyi_sms, | ||
| mskyi_sms, | |||
| integer, dimension(nspmd+1) | fr_sms, | ||
| integer, dimension(nspmd+1) | fr_rms, | ||
| integer, dimension(*) | list_sms, | ||
| integer, dimension(*) | list_rms, | ||
| mskyi_fi_sms, | |||
| vfi, | |||
| integer, dimension(*) | imv, | ||
| mv, | |||
| double precision, dimension(6,3,*) | mv6, | ||
| double precision, dimension(6,3,*) | mw6, | ||
| ms, | |||
| integer | nodft, | ||
| integer | nodlt, | ||
| prec_sms, | |||
| integer, dimension(*) | kinet ) |
Definition at line 499 of file sms_proj.F.
| subroutine sms_inist | ( | type(timer_), intent(inout) | timers, |
| integer, dimension(*) | iadk, | ||
| integer, dimension(*) | jdik, | ||
| diag_k, | |||
| lt_k, | |||
| integer | itask, | ||
| integer | nodft1_sms, | ||
| integer | nodlt1_sms, | ||
| integer, dimension(*) | indx1_sms, | ||
| integer, dimension(*) | nodnx_sms, | ||
| integer, dimension(2,nspmd+1) | iad_elem, | ||
| integer, dimension(*) | fr_elem, | ||
| integer, dimension(*) | weight, | ||
| integer, dimension(*) | jadi_sms, | ||
| integer, dimension(*) | jdii_sms, | ||
| lti_sms, | |||
| integer, dimension(lskyi_sms,*) | iskyi_sms, | ||
| mskyi_sms, | |||
| integer, dimension(nspmd+1) | fr_sms, | ||
| integer, dimension(nspmd+1) | fr_rms, | ||
| integer, dimension(*) | list_sms, | ||
| integer, dimension(*) | list_rms, | ||
| mskyi_fi_sms, | |||
| vfi, | |||
| integer, dimension(*) | imv, | ||
| mv, | |||
| double precision, dimension(6,3,*) | mv6, | ||
| double precision, dimension(6,3,*) | mw6, | ||
| ms, | |||
| integer | nodft, | ||
| integer | nodlt ) |
Definition at line 38 of file sms_proj.F.
| subroutine sms_inix | ( | type(timer_), intent(inout) | timers, |
| integer | nodft, | ||
| integer | nodlt, | ||
| integer | numnod, | ||
| x, | |||
| r, | |||
| integer, dimension(*) | weight, | ||
| integer | itask, | ||
| diag_sms ) |
Definition at line 182 of file sms_proj.F.
| subroutine sms_mam_nm | ( | integer | nodft, |
| integer | nodlt, | ||
| integer | numnod, | ||
| integer | md, | ||
| a, | |||
| b, | |||
| c, | |||
| integer, dimension(*) | weight, | ||
| integer | itask ) |
Definition at line 989 of file sms_proj.F.
| subroutine sms_mav_mn | ( | integer | nd, |
| integer | md, | ||
| a, | |||
| b, | |||
| c, | |||
| integer | itask ) |
Definition at line 1093 of file sms_proj.F.
| subroutine sms_mav_nm | ( | integer | nodft, |
| integer | nodlt, | ||
| integer | numnod, | ||
| integer | md, | ||
| a, | |||
| b, | |||
| c, | |||
| integer, dimension(*) | weight, | ||
| integer | itask ) |
Definition at line 948 of file sms_proj.F.
| subroutine sms_mortho_gs | ( | integer | nodft, |
| integer | nodlt, | ||
| integer | numnod, | ||
| integer | md_f, | ||
| integer | md_l, | ||
| a, | |||
| integer, dimension(*) | weight, | ||
| integer | itask ) |
Definition at line 1036 of file sms_proj.F.
| subroutine sms_pro_p | ( | type(timer_), intent(inout) | timers, |
| integer | nodft, | ||
| integer | nodlt, | ||
| integer | numnod, | ||
| p, | |||
| integer, dimension(*) | weight, | ||
| integer | itask, | ||
| pj, | |||
| diag_sms ) |
Definition at line 300 of file sms_proj.F.
| subroutine sms_produt3 | ( | integer | nodft, |
| integer | nodlt, | ||
| x, | |||
| y, | |||
| integer, dimension(*) | weight, | ||
| r, | |||
| integer | itask ) |
Definition at line 783 of file sms_proj.F.
| subroutine sms_produt_h | ( | integer | nodft, |
| integer | nodlt, | ||
| x, | |||
| y, | |||
| integer, dimension(*) | weight, | ||
| r, | |||
| integer | itask ) |
Definition at line 662 of file sms_proj.F.
| subroutine sms_produt_v_loc | ( | integer | nddl, |
| x, | |||
| y, | |||
| r ) |
Definition at line 1138 of file sms_proj.F.
| subroutine sms_updst | ( | integer, dimension(*) | iadk, |
| integer, dimension(*) | jdik, | ||
| diag_k, | |||
| lt_k, | |||
| integer | itask, | ||
| integer | nodft1_sms, | ||
| integer | nodlt1_sms, | ||
| integer, dimension(*) | indx1_sms, | ||
| integer, dimension(*) | nodnx_sms, | ||
| integer, dimension(2,nspmd+1) | iad_elem, | ||
| integer, dimension(*) | fr_elem, | ||
| integer, dimension(*) | weight, | ||
| integer, dimension(*) | jadi_sms, | ||
| integer, dimension(*) | jdii_sms, | ||
| lti_sms, | |||
| integer, dimension(lskyi_sms,*) | iskyi_sms, | ||
| mskyi_sms, | |||
| integer, dimension(nspmd+1) | fr_sms, | ||
| integer, dimension(nspmd+1) | fr_rms, | ||
| integer, dimension(*) | list_sms, | ||
| integer, dimension(*) | list_rms, | ||
| mskyi_fi_sms, | |||
| vfi, | |||
| integer, dimension(*) | imv, | ||
| mv, | |||
| double precision, dimension(6,*) | mv6, | ||
| double precision, dimension(6,*) | mw6, | ||
| ms, | |||
| u, | |||
| p, | |||
| y, | |||
| integer | nodft, | ||
| integer | nodlt, | ||
| integer, dimension(*) | kinet ) |
Definition at line 408 of file sms_proj.F.